It’s another cold morning, but we’ll warm up nicely by the afternoon.
Partly cloudy skies this morning become more cloudy by the afternoon. Most of today should stay dry, although a few isolated showers are possible later this evening.
Temperatures continue to warm tomorrow (Christmas Eve). It does look likely that we’ll see some light rain showers for the second half of the day.
A few more showers are possible the first half of Christmas Day.
We’ll dry out for most of Sunday, however, another round of rain is likely Sunday overnight into Monday morning.
Enjoy the above normal temperatures through the holiday weekend: we’ll cool down again heading into next week. Still no signs of significant snow in the forecast.
Today: Mostly cloudy, breezy. High 42.
Tonight: Mostly cloudy. Low 34.
Friday (Christmas Eve): Cloudy. PM rain showers. High 52.
Saturday (Christmas Day): Cloudy. Few rain showers. High 48.
Sunday: Mostly cloudy, rain overnight. High 46.
